South Korea is considering the deployment of military assets and troops to the Strait of Hormuz, according to regional reporting.

Seoul Weighs Deployment to the Strait of Hormuz

According to reports from CNN Indonesia, DetikNews, Tribunnews, Hidayatullah, and Warta Ekonomi, the South Korean government is actively weighing whether to join American efforts to protect commercial shipping lanes in the vital waterway. Outlets note that Seoul has faced diplomatic pressure to contribute to maritime security operations in the region.

Did you know? The Strait of Hormuz is a critical choke point for global energy supplies, through which a significant portion of the world’s petroleum passes daily.

Iran Issues Warnings Against Foreign Coalition Forces

Tehran has issued direct warnings to South Korea regarding any potential military participation in the U.S.-led coalition. According to Warta Ekonomi, Iranian officials caution that joining foreign naval patrols in the Persian Gulf could strain bilateral relations between Seoul and Tehran.

Strategic Implications for South Korean Security Policy

Tribunnews reports that Seoul’s military planners have targeted a timeframe stretching toward late 2026 for potential asset readiness, though final policy decisions remain under review. Hidayatullah notes that the debate centers on balancing robust alliance commitments with Washington against stable economic and diplomatic ties in the Middle East.
